A Malmstrom Air Force Base airman was arrested Wednesday on suspicion of six counts of sexual intercourse without consent (the Montana statute for rape) and one count of aggravated sexual intercourse without consent.

The following information comes directly from charging documents. The defendant is considered innocent until proven guilty.

On May 9, the U.S. Air Force Office of Special Investigations received information that Cleve Charles Nelson, 31, had reportedly been sexually abusing a 17-year-old girl over the course of four months.

The girl told Nelson's ex-spouse about the alleged rapes while Nelson was out of town on a work trip. The affidavit states the girl had text messages from Nelson that included nude photos, messages about the rapes, messages about hiding the rapes and messages about Nelson purchasing Plan B birth control.

Nelson's ex-spouse confronted Nelson, and he reportedly answered via text message, "I'm sorry I let everyone down ... I would hate for this to escalate further, but I will face the consequences of my actions. I'm not a bad person, but there is a problem with my self-control." The woman reported the alleged rapes to Malmstrom Security Forces.

During an interview with law enforcement, the woman reported that Nelson had also raped her about twice a month during their marriage and had filmed them having sex without her consent.

During a forensic interview, the girl said Nelson had raped her at least six times, getting her intoxicated, holding her down and sometimes strangling her. Nelson also allegedly recorded the rapes and sent the girl illicit photos of himself.

When police interviewed Nelson, he claimed he and the girl had sex consensually.

Nelson is being held at the Cascade County Detention Center on a $100,000 bond.
